    A stroller is one of the most expensive baby purchases new parents will make. The stroller is among the most sought-after items on baby registry lists, so it's crucial to choose the right one.

    Take into consideration the following aspects such as weight and portability, as well as safety, comfort, and ease of use. Find out more tips and advice on the best single stroller available for sale.

    Lightweight

    A single convertible stroller stroller for sale that is light and easy to move can save you much time on your walks. The models listed here are ideal for busy parents as they come with convenient storage for baby bags, shopping bags, and snacks. Many also include an effective break system as well as robust wheels that allow for safe and comfortable strolling. Some models even include built-in bassinets for newborns or young babies.

    If you're looking to purchase a light, simple travel stroller this model from Babyzen fits the bill. It's narrower than other strollers, making it easier to maneuver around crowds of people on urban streets. It folds down into a small, compact size that can be tucked away in the trunk of your car or in the overhead bin on a plane. It's an excellent choice for those who reside in urban areas or who plan to travel often with their children.

    The Contours Itsy is another lightweight stroller that's perfect for travel. This model has an exclusive tri-fold design, which makes it more compact than other strollers. It's also simple to assemble with only a few clicks. It's also a basic stroller that is lightweight. You won't find additional features like cup holders or oversized bags to make it heavier and make it more difficult to store.

    Nuna TRVL is another option for a light stroller that's ideal for traveling with a toddler. It may not be as compact as the Babyzen YoYO2 or the Munchkin Sparrow but it can be folded to a compact size. It is easy to store and transport. It also comes with a large under-seat storage basket and a footrest that can also be used as an handle when the stroller is folded.

    The only downside to this stroller is that it's not as sturdy as the other options on this list. It's not the best option for families that plan to gate-check it on flights, since baggage handlers could break the back of the footrest. The handlebar isn't padded and can't be adjusted, which means it may not be suitable for taller parents.

    Easy to maneuver

    If you're planning to visit the city for an escape for the weekend or just an easy stroll around the neighborhood, you need an easy-to-use stroller that is easy to move around. The best strollers for travel are compact and lightweight which makes it easy to transport them on planes, trains or in cars. These strollers are also smaller and less bulky, which is great for those who live in apartment or have a little storage space. These models are ideal for urban parents as they're often designed to be able to navigate busy streets and narrow sidewalks.

    The Babyzen Yoyo+ stroller is a great choice for travelers because it is lightweight and compact enough to fit in most trunks. It's also a bit narrower than other strollers, which makes it easier to maneuver through crowds on sidewalks. Despite its diminutive size, it has a lot of features including a large under-seat basket, five-point harness, a reclining seat, and an extended sun shade to cover most kids' heads (although we would prefer that the canopy was more inclined). It comes with a travel bag and car seat adapters that fit Nuna Pipa/MaxiCosi/Cybex/UPPAbaby Me carseats. The only issue is that the handlebar is a little high and doesn't adjust to a certain height, which could be an issue for some shorter adults.

    The Munchkin Sparrow is another travel-friendly option that's light and compact. It's a perfect fit for families that want to stay clear of baggage fees and are ready to pack up the stroller in a flash. It's easy to move, has a built-in cup holder and storage tray. It's a bit more expensive than the Babyzen Yoyo+, but it also has a bit more in terms of features it has an adjustable handlebar, a reclining seat, and a bumper bar that is padded.

    The right single stroller will depend on the age and needs of your child. If your child's a newborn and you need a travel system which is compatible with a car seat. If they're a toddler, you'll require an easy-to-use, compact stroller that is able to make sharp turns and go over bumps.

    Safety

    A great stroller makes walking with your child enjoyable and enjoyable. It must be sturdy, have strong handles, excellent brakes and be free of any parts that could pinch the fingers of children or create a choking risk. It should also have a wide wheel base and be sturdy enough to keep the seat low within the frame. It should also have a good canopy, as well as convenient storage areas.

    Consumer Product Safety Commission has strict safety standards for strollers for children. This includes safe hinges, wheel locks and seat belts. Some importers and retailers might not comply with these guidelines, so it's important to check your prospective stroller carefully before you buy it.

    The ideal single stroller should be easy to maneuver, and comfortable for parents. It is recommended to look for one that can be folded in one hand and fits into the trunk of your car. It should also have tires made of foam that don't flatten easily and can take on uneven terrain without any hassle. You should also opt for a stroller with lockable front wheels, which will let you navigate curbs and narrow sidewalks with confidence.

    It is crucial to select a stroller that is made to fit your child's age, height, and weight. Toddlers should be able sit up with their heads supported. newborns should be able to lie down completely. Make sure you have a secure restraint system with shoulder straps, a belt, and adjustable handrests.

    If you're looking for a stroller be sure to think about your budget. If you want to save money, you can shop at discount stores or purchase used. Also, be sure to register your stroller with the manufacturer. This will ensure that you get any recall notices promptly.
